Virtual Symposium: Bridging the Divide - Machine Learning in Medicine

A bridge
Thursday, February 18, 2021

The second Maching Learning in Medicine inter-campus symposium will be held virtually to bring together researchers and clinicians to present recent work and initiate collaborations.

The symposium, "Bridging the Divide", will be organized into three sessions, with each session spanning over two consecutive days. The first session will focus on computational biology and will be held from 9:30 to 11:30 a.m. (EST) Thursday and Friday, February 18 and 19. The second session will focus on health records and statistical methods and will be held 9:30 a.m. to noon (EST) Thursday and Friday, March 4 and 5. The final session will focus on neuroimaging and will be held from 9:30 a.m. to noon (EST), Thursday and Friday, March 11 and March 12.

To attend, join via Zoom, and visit the MLiM website for further details.

This symposium is organised by Drs. Amy Kuceyeski, Mert Sabuncu, Jyotishman Pathak, Chris Mason, Fei Wang, and Martin Wells.
